How to Find an Accident Attorney
New York law allows compensation for losses and injuries, regardless of whether the incident occurred on a road or in your own neighborhood. Insurance companies are not willing to pay compensation to victims of losses and injuries.
Seek medical attention as soon as you can - a gap in treatment is among the most frequent reasons insurance companies will decline or limit the amount of your injury claim.
Experience
Accidents in cars can be devastating for the victim and their families. They can cause them to be left without a way to make ends meet especially when medical bills and insurance claims start to accumulate. This makes it more important to find an attorney who can help navigate the maze of legal procedures and ensure you receive the compensation you are entitled to.
The most skilled lawyers are familiar with these kinds of cases, and they understand the complexities involved. They will also be familiar with local laws and court procedures. They will be aware of the evidence needed to establish your case and the best method to get it, including interviewing witnesses. They can negotiate with insurance companies to avoid common pitfalls for example, accepting a low initial settlement offer.
They will be able to evaluate the extent of your injuries and make suggestions for a fair appraisal of your non-economic damages such as suffering and pain. While these aren't quantifiable with a price tag, they can significantly impact your overall quality of life and ability to work as well as take pleasure in your hobbies. Injuries that are severe can cause chronic pain, PTSD or a restriction on your ability to perform physical activities.
If you're having trouble choosing the right attorney, try asking family or friends for recommendations. They can provide you with their experiences was like and if they were satisfied with the result of their case. You can also visit the websites of different attorneys and go through their bios to know more about their backgrounds and experience.
You should also ask potential attorneys about their fee structure. Many personal injury attorneys do not charge fees unless they get a settlement for their client or a verdict. In these instances, the lawyers will take a percentage from the judgment. This usually amounts to about one third. This is referred to as contingency fees.
An attorney's hiring can result in extra costs, especially when you are unable to work after your accident. However, these lawyers are typically required if you hope to seek compensation that is greater than what the initial settlement offered by your insurance company offer will cover.

Fees
The aftermath of a car accident can be extremely stressful. It's stressful enough to manage medical treatments and dealing with insurance companies, and take on work responsibilities without having legal issues to worry about. It is essential to select an attorney for your car accident that doesn't cause stress in your life by charging you excessively.
Most car accident injury lawyers near me attorneys work on a contingency basis, meaning they don't charge fees upfront and only receive a portion of your total compensation as their fee for representation. This arrangement is perfect, as it allows victims to get legal help even if they don't have the money. This arrangement ensures that car accident attorneys (https://chessdatabase.science/) will do everything they can to maximize your settlement.
A reputable attorney will determine the amount of compensation you deserve, taking into account the economic and noneconomic costs like medical bills and lost wages. They also know how insurance companies work and can counter any tactics that they might use to decrease the amount of your settlement. They will also negotiate with hospitals and medical providers in order to lower the cost of your treatment, so that you will receive more of your compensation.
The fees that an attorney charges for a car crash can differ depending on a variety of factors. A lawyer may charge a retainer when they accept your case, which will be taken out of their contingency fees at the conclusion. They'll also take into consideration any additional expenses, like court reporter's fees, filing fees, or language translation services.
The level of experience and expertise of your lawyer will affect the price they charge for their services.
